Jabra debuts the JX20 Pura

Two years ago, Jabra wowed us with the Jabra JX10, a tiny yet elegant Bluetooth headset with plenty of power behind its design. This year, Jabra has done it again, with the Jabra JX20 Pura. Designed by Jacob Jensen, the same famous European designer that designed the JX10, the JX20 Pura simply oozes luxury. It is made with brushed, anodized titanium and has a glossy black trim all around, plus it has an innovative gel earbud for better comfort. As for features, it comes with digital sound enhancement via DSP, as much as six hours of talk time, adaptive sound, plus support for Bluetooth 2.0 and autopairing. The JX20 Pura will be available for $179.
